Brief Smartphone Treatment Study for Anxiety and Depression
This study aims to examine the efficacy and effectiveness of a brief 14-day smartphone-delivered treatment on depressed and anxious individuals, particularly university undergraduates. We hope that the brief treatment will help to alleviate psychological distress.
Owns a smartphone compatible with the treatment app (iPhone or all Android phones except for Life’s Good brand). Aged 18 years and above. Motivated to seek treatment for anxiety and depression. Fluent in the English language in terms of speaking, listening, reading, and writing.
Exclusion Criteria:
Unable to consent. Has a mental health condition that warrants in-person professional mental health treatment. Unable to commit to the study duration for whatever reasons. Unable to speak, read, listen, and write English fluently.
